Perhaps the least surprising 2022 primary poll yet appeared in Wyoming over the weekend. A Mason-Dixon survey for the Casper Star-Tribune showed former Republican National Committee member and Trump endorsee Harriet Hageman leading three-term incumbent congresswoman Liz Cheney by a 52 to 30 percent margin. Cheney’s current star turn in Washington as the vice-chair of the House select committee investigating January 6 will likely be her swan song in Congress and perhaps in the Republican Party.
Initially, it seemed as if Cheney might survive in 2022 because so many Republicans wanted to be the instrument of Trump’s revenge, as I noted in July of last year:
The large field of opponents Cheney has attracted means she could win a primary with a relatively small percentage of the vote; indeed, she won her first nomination for a House race in 2016 with less than 40 percent of the vote.
That process of MAGA consolidation began in September 2021, when Trump endorsed Hageman. The new poll shows no one other than Cheney or Hageman with over 5 percent of the vote. Mason-Dixon managing director Brad Coker commented, “The big story is Liz Cheney is going to get beat … That’s a foregone conclusion.” Her job-approval rating among likely primary voters is a terrible 27 percent, with 66 disapproving, and 54 percent say Cheney’s performance on the January 6 committee made it less likely they would vote for her.
Cheney’s campaign has already resorted to pleas for Democratic support. Wyoming requires Republican affiliation for participants in Republican primaries, but any registered voter can change that affiliation up to and including Primary Day. The trouble is registered Republicans outnumber registered Democrats in Wyoming by nearly a five-to-one margin, so there just aren’t enough Democrats there to save Cheney’s bacon given her very low status in her own party.
